Question 987120: TWO AUTOMOBILES TRAVEL AT THE RATE OF 50 MPH AND 30 MPH RESPECTIVELY. THE FASTER TRAVELS 2 HRS MORE THAN THE OTHER AND GOES 140 MILES FARTHER. FIND THE DISTANCE TRAVELED BY EACH.

The faster car's time is:
+t+%2B+2+ hrs
The slower car's time is:
+t+ hrs
-----------------------
The faster car's distance is:
+d+%2B+140+
The slower car's distance is:
+d+
-------------------------
Faster car's equation:
(1) +d+%2B+140+=+50%2A%28+t+%2B+2+%29+
Slower car's equation:
(2) +d+=+30t+
--------------------
Substitute (2) into (1)
(1) +30t+%2B+140+=+50%2A%28+t+%2B+2+%29+
(1) +30t+%2B+140+=+50t+%2B+100+
(1) +20t+=+40+
(1) +t+=+2+
---------------
(2) +d+=+30t+
(2) +d+=+30%2A2+
(2) +d+=+60+ mi
and
(1) +d+%2B+140+=+50%2A%28+t+%2B+2+%29+
(1) +d+%2B+140+=+50%2A%28+2+%2B+2+%29+
(1) +d+%2B+140+=+200+
-----------------------
The faster car travels +200+ mi
The slower car travels +60+ mi
